Output d606a281221dc5fbc8cc65dc91f634488697433d842ec1681305e42adf9ea1fc:0

value
48490000
script pubkey
OP_0 OP_PUSHBYTES_20 7b79a8e416039ddf8034afc0a955f051f8186b64
address
bc1q0du63eqkqwwalqp54lq2j40s28ups6mytmuf6j
transaction
d606a281221dc5fbc8cc65dc91f634488697433d842ec1681305e42adf9ea1fc
confirmations
70773
spent
true